The BSA/Solar Fluor 532 antibody is a valuable tool for detecting Bovine Serum Albumin (BSA) in various applications. Here, we provide protocols for the validated application key: IF (Immunofluorescence).
For IF, the following steps are recommended:
- Reagents or buffers: PBS, BSA/Solar Fluor 532 antibody, secondary antibody if necessary, mounting medium with DAPI.
- Sample preparation: Fix cells or tissue sections with 4% paraformaldehyde, permeabilize with 0.1% Triton X-100 if necessary.
- Antibody incubation: Incubate samples with BSA/Solar Fluor 532 antibody at a dilution of 1:50-500 in PBS with 1% BSA for 1 hour at room temperature or overnight at 4°C.
- Washing or detection: Wash samples thoroughly with PBS, then incubate with secondary antibody if necessary. Detect using a fluorescence microscope.
- Technical notes: Optimize antibody dilution and incubation time based on specific experimental conditions. Controls without primary antibody should be included to assess background fluorescence.
